Low-Power, Single/Dual-Voltage µP Reset Circuits with Capacitor-Adjustable Reset Timeout Delay The MAX6420UK26+T is a microprocessor (μP) supervisory circuit manufactured by Maxim Integrated.  

### **Specifications:**  
- **Manufacturer:** Maxim Integrated  
- **Part Number:** MAX6420UK26+T  
- **Type:** Voltage Monitor / Supervisor  
- **Reset Threshold Voltage:** 2.63V (fixed)  
- **Operating Voltage Range:** 1.2V to 5.5V  
- **Output Type:** Active-Low, Push-Pull  
- **Reset Timeout Period:** 140ms (min)  
- **Operating Temperature Range:** -40°C to +85°C  
- **Package:** SOT23-5  

### **Descriptions:**  
The MAX6420UK26+T monitors the voltage of a microprocessor or digital system and asserts a reset signal when the voltage drops below a preset threshold (2.63V). It ensures proper system operation by holding the reset signal until the supply voltage stabilizes.  

### **Features:**  
- **Precision Voltage Monitoring:** Guaranteed reset threshold accuracy of ±1.5%.  
- **Low Quiescent Current:** 6μA (typical).  
- **No External Components Required:** Simplifies design.  
- **Push-Pull RESET Output:** Eliminates the need for a pull-up resistor.  
- **Wide Operating Voltage Range:** Supports 1.2V to 5.5V systems.  
- **Small Form Factor:** Available in a compact SOT23-5 package.  

This device is commonly used in embedded systems, industrial controls, and battery-powered applications where reliable power monitoring is critical.
